Our icemaker is not refilling with water. This happened suddenly. Since it is 7 years old, I am reluctant to spend a lot of money.
The icemaker previously didn't fill whereas the water dispenser has never failed. The previous time I suspected the valve,
ordered a new one, then looked at the location and decided I could not do it myself. The valve is at the lower right
near the floor and, at 73 years old, was not something I could do and then regain mobility.
That time I also suspected a faulty water filter. (This model uses filters with two nipples.) Discovered an internet post
that the problem could be caused by calcium buildup. Ordered and installed a new filter housing and the problem
was resolved - that time. (The housing can be taken apart, o-rings cleaned, reassembled...)
